<h1>2.5.0 (2025-06-18)</h1>
<h2>Features</h2>
<ul>
<li>Added support for the <code>compression.zstd</code> module that is
new in Python 3.14.
See <code>PEP 784 &lt;https://peps.python.org/pep-0784/&gt;</code>_ for
more information.
(<code>[#3610](urllib3/urllib3#3610)
&lt;https://github.com/urllib3/urllib3/issues/3610&gt;</code>__)</li>
<li>Added support for version 0.5 of <code>hatch-vcs</code>
(<code>[#3612](urllib3/urllib3#3612)
&lt;https://github.com/urllib3/urllib3/issues/3612&gt;</code>__)</li>
</ul>
<h2>Bugfixes</h2>
<ul>
<li>Fixed a security issue where restricting the maximum number of
followed
redirects at the <code>urllib3.PoolManager</code> level via the
<code>retries</code> parameter
did not work.</li>
<li>Made the Node.js runtime respect redirect parameters such as
<code>retries</code>
and <code>redirects</code>.</li>
<li>Raised exception for <code>HTTPResponse.shutdown</code> on a
connection already released to the pool.
(<code>[#3581](urllib3/urllib3#3581)
&lt;https://github.com/urllib3/urllib3/issues/3581&gt;</code>__)</li>
<li>Fixed incorrect <code>CONNECT</code> statement when using an IPv6
proxy with <code>connection_from_host</code>. Previously would not be
wrapped in <code>[]</code>.
(<code>[#3615](urllib3/urllib3#3615)
&lt;https://github.com/urllib3/urllib3/issues/3615&gt;</code>__)</li>
</ul>
